Transaction 68387a574e976382e291f484c0535203f6ef418c752bb43a49d90d4c124e56aa
1 Input
1 Output
-
68387a574e976382e291f484c0535203f6ef418c752bb43a49d90d4c124e56aa:0
- value
- 88828
- script pubkey
- OP_DUP OP_HASH160 OP_PUSHBYTES_20 db34e73feeb53a15786910d57250a8a409d20531 OP_EQUALVERIFY OP_CHECKSIG
- address
- 1Lz4MoHE2nCbydzb7YbPwbuM33HVuZAYSj